Sweat Free Skin-Care
I’m currently sporting a breakout not seen since my years of wearing Lancôme Juicy Tubes. The mixture of stagnant air, sunscreen, grubby public transport hands and Aperol Spritz’s has wreaked havoc on my sensitive dermis. I’m cleansing like a lunatic with Dr Levy’s glycolic face wash. It’s a fantastic product and triples up as a quick peel and micro-dermabrasion should your skin need a deeper seeing to. Just ensure you don’t forget to wear an SPF whilst using it or risk some very minging hyper-pigmentation and sunburn. Hydration wise, I’ve swapped out my moisturiser for this bomb hyaluronic acid followed by but a simple tinted SPF. This one from Heliocare is exceptional.

Low Maintenance Make Up
Make up wise – less is more. Nothing looks and feels more appalling than wearing foundation in Hades, even if it does mean showcasing my adult acne to anyone who’s unlucky enough to catch me in profile. I use the tinted SPF 50 which offers decent-ish coverage then do my Hourglass bronzer, Illamsqua lip liner and the merest wash of Nars shadow in Lola Lola. I’ve also been forgoing mascara. It slips off in a hot second and all of a sudden you’ve careered dangerously into JBF (just been fornicated) territory before the work day has even begun – to be clear, this is a bad look Monday through Friday.
Lipstick or gloss of any permutation is also a firm no from me, thanks.

Say No To Croissant Skin
Speaking of getting fucked – Witnessing clouds of dead skin billowing off your Pilates leggings is the dreaded ‘winter leg’ at its very best. How not to let your gams look like you’ve been partying with the Olsen Twins? You will body brush every day, you will moisturise religiously and you will apply olive oil to your entire body BEFORE you shower. It sounds annoying but you’ll soon be enjoying the perks of having dolphin soft skin rubbing against your Rixo dress and really is there anything more beautiful than that? I think not.
